Things to do in Archdale?
Archdale, North Carolina is a small town located in Randolph County. It is known for its strong community spirit and close proximity to the larger city of Greensboro. Archdale has plenty to offer, from outdoor recreation like hiking trails and lakes to shopping, dining, and entertainment options. The town also boasts easy access to major highways and nearby cities like Charlotte and Winston-Salem. With its scenic streets and family-friendly atmosphere, Archdale is an excellent place to live or visit.
